
Continuing the morning session on November 22, the National Assembly listened to Secretary General of the National Assembly and Head of the National Assembly Office Bui Van Cuong, on behalf of the National Assembly Standing Committee, present a Report on adjusting the Program of the 6th Session of the 15th National Assembly.
Based on the opinions of National Assembly deputies discussed at the meeting on November 3 and agencies, on November 16, at the meeting between the two sessions of the 6th Session, the National Assembly Standing Committee gave unified opinions on many contents to absorb and revise the draft Land Law (amended).
Because the draft Law still has some major policy contents that need further research to design optimal plans and policies, the comprehensive review and completion of the draft Law needs more time to ensure the constitutionality, legality and consistency of the draft Law with the legal system.
“This is a particularly important Law project, greatly affecting socio-economic activities and people's lives. Therefore, after reaching an agreement with the Government, the National Assembly Standing Committee reports to the National Assembly for permission to adjust the time for passing the Land Law project (amended) from this session to the nearest session of the National Assembly to continue studying, absorbing, revising, reviewing reserves and perfecting the draft Law, ensuring the best quality before submitting it to the National Assembly for approval,” Mr. Bui Van Cuong emphasized.
As a result, 91.70% of delegates participating in the vote approved the adjustment of the program of the 6th Session.
